Is email marketing part of your business strategy for 2022? πŸ“§

Here's why YOU ABSOLUTELY SHOULD take advantage of the contacts you own!

βœ… Emails are personal
Take advantage of the personalisation that emails offer and connect with your audience through 1 on 1 approach.
("Hey Buddy" is not the answer)

βœ… Email marketing is one of the most cost-effective (FREE) ways to talk to your subscribers. ROI stands at Β£42 for every Β£1 spent according to DMA. Winner!

βœ… You OWN your contact list.
You're in charge on how you connect with your contacts. You don't own your social media followers - their companies do and they make the rules.

This is just a friendly reminder of the social media outage that happened in October '21. When social media goes down and you're business is up the creek and can't communicate...

βœ… Faster word of mouth
Your existing customers are more likely to forward your newsletter, newest offer to their contacts than any other channel. They create the buzz for you.

βœ… Emails are still going strong
Despite all the social media platforms or a new advertising technique on the block, emails have been going for a very long time now and they're not going anywhere.

3 ways to communicate using TrelloπŸ‘Œ

Imagine the scene.

You have an urgent task that needs doing.

You have emailed and commented on a card in Trello but there's no response.

How else are you supposed to escalate the urgency?

Personally, I'm falling more and more in love with Trello and the features it has to offer.

Why?
Trello is a user friendly and intuitive task workflow platform
It can be integrated with your email, cloud storage or calendar
It's free up to 10 boards

So how can you communicate with it effectively?

Slack - is a free instant messaging tool that can be integrated with Trello. Communicate with you team/clients, directly from Trello, from a specific card, and action straight from Slack.

Trello Butler - is an automation function within Trello where you can set rules for different behaviours of a card. I.e. set a rule ' card label is changed to red 'urgent' which will automatically send an personalized email to the card owner to action'.

Trello Chat - this Power-up feature is amazing! You can have conversation WITHIN the board. Not just in the card. So this could be non task related, but team/project related.

This is to give you a taste of what is Trello good for....the opportunities are endless.
